Output 0618d27eec8fd6c4f8b65436729848920ce18f1a79aeeaf7d64d34fd4415c440:6

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ebba550dacc4cb28c16c410d4f7b26e574be92 OP_EQUAL
address
3CMEhTLifxSVYW4EXmnPb3b6oDBnkHhvBW
transaction
0618d27eec8fd6c4f8b65436729848920ce18f1a79aeeaf7d64d34fd4415c440
spent
true